Originally posted by vulpina
Actually, keep the soil moist, alot of blondi's are lost in molts from not being humid enough.
If only it were that simple. Plenty of blondis die moulting in swamp like conditions. There's even a number of keepers out there keeping them, shudder, dry and succeeding.

Blondis are prone to bad moults throughout their sling and juvenile stages. This much is true.

That humidity has anything to do with it is at best possibly true but by no means backed up by any actual evidence, and at worst is simply a popularly repeated bit of advice with no actual backing other than the fact that it gets repeated a lot.
